We are looking for a Transportation Drainage Engineer with broad ranging experience in highway and/or rail drainage design to join our Transportation team in either Manchester or Warrington.
You will be responsible for designing drainage elements of significant highway and/or rail drainage infrastructure projects, delivering to the highest technical standards and quality targets. You will be an experienced drainage designer with proven ability who takes ownership and responsibility for design solutions.
Responsibilities:
Technical
- Working within a multi-disciplinary team of engineers, technicians and other professionals to develop drainage designs for highways or rail projects from concept through to detailed design and construction.
- Production of drainage designs, models, calculations and drawings to current design standards including the design of sustainable drainage solutions.
- Co-ordinating the drainage design process and integrating with associated highways, rail, environmental, geotechnical and structural engineering designs.
- Arranging and supervising the completion of drainage surveys.
- Assigning tasks, monitoring progress and checking of designs prepared by graduates and technicians.
- Preparing specifications; tender and contract documents and providing support to site during the construction process.
- Ensuring compliance with business management standards set in the company’s quality, safety and environmental policies and procedures.

Requirements:
Technical
- Chartered Engineer (or working to) and Member of a Professional Institution (relevant discipline)
- Experience of working on Highways England, Local Authority or Network Rail drainage design projects.
- Experience of the current standards (DMRB / Network Rail) and Construction Design Management Regulations (CDM).
- Ability to design all aspects of drainage from concept to detailed design.
- Experience of design interfaces (e.g. highways, rail, geotechnical, environmental, structural etc.)
- Proficient in the use of hydraulic modelling software such as Micro Drainage.
- Proficient in AutoCAD / Civil3D or similar.
- Familiarity with 3D design tools and BIM.
- Ability to prepare reports and specifications and to collect and assimilate other data and statistics necessary for the preparation of progress and technical reports.
- Proficient in all Microsoft Office software particularly MS Excel and Word.
- Awareness of the regulatory framework associated with planning and approval regulations/processes, together with experience of managing a transportation drainage project through the planning process.
- Experience of site, construction contracts and of site management desirable.
